India’s Injuries Force Squad Changes Before 4th Test

News summary

India faces major injury setbacks ahead of the fourth Test against England in Manchester, with all-rounder Nitish Kumar Reddy ruled out of the series due to a left knee injury and set to return home for rehabilitation. Arshdeep Singh is sidelined from the fourth Test after suffering a left thumb injury in practice, and his recovery is being monitored by the BCCI medical team. Uncapped all-rounder Anshul Kamboj has been added to the squad to address these gaps. Akash Deep remains a fitness concern, and Jasprit Bumrah's participation is uncertain as India manages his workload. Reddy's absence is notable after his strong performances at Lord's, and Shardul Thakur may be brought back into the XI as a seam-bowling all-rounder. Trailing 1-2 in the five-match series, India must adapt its bowling attack and team composition for this must-win Test.
